본문 바로가기
CS API

판매자문의 조회 API

Description
[POST] https://sa2.esmplus.com/item/v1/communications/customer/bulletin-board
고객이 상품 및 주문관련 문의한 내용을 조회합니다,

Request Description

항목 항목명 필수여부 Type Description
qnaType 조회구분 Y int 조회 구분
1 : 옥션(일반)
2 : 옥션(비밀글)
3 : 전체(G마켓은 해당 구분만 사용)
status 처리상태 Y int 문의 답변 처리상태 관련 조회
1 : 전체
2 : 미처리
3 : 처리완료
4 : 처리중(G마켓용)
5 : 중복문의(G마켓용)
type 조회기준 구분 Y int 조회기준 구분 (접수일로만 지원)
1 : 접수일
startDate 조회기준 시작일 Y date - YYYY-MM-DD 형식으로 입력
- 7일 단위로 조회 가능
endDate 조회기준 종료일 Y date - YYYY-MM-DD 형식으로 입력
- 7일 단위로 조회 가능
- 당일 조회시 시작일 +1일로 조회
JSON
{
  "status": int,
  "qnaType": int,
  "type": int,
  "startDate": "2019-04-15",
  "endDate": "2019-04-15"
}

 

Response Description

항목 항목명 Type Description
resultCode 결과코드 int 실패했을 경우 에러코드 내려감
message 메시지 string 실패사유
token 토큰 string 답변 작성 시, 문의번호와 token 함께 요청되어야 함
QnaType 사이트구분 int 조회된 게시판
1 : 옥션(일반)
2 : 옥션(비밀글)
3 : 전체
SellerId 판매자 사이트ID string  
contractType 문의유형 string [옥션]
전체,상품(성능/사이즈),배송,교환,반품/취소/환불,기타

[G마켓]
상품, 배송, 반품/환불, 교환, 취소, 안전거래, 기타
InformStatus 문의답변상태 string 문의에 답변이 처리되었은지 여부
미처리, 처리완료
ReAsking 재질문여부 Boolean 옥션/G마켓 기준 재질문인지 여부 체크
true: 재질문
false : 재질문 아님
MessageNo 문의번호 string 문의번호 기준으로 답변 처리 필요
중복문의 동일건 문의에 대해 No별 관리 필요
ReceiveDate 접수일시 date - 판매자 문의 발생 시간
- YYYY-MM-DD hh:mm:ss+09:00 형식으로 조회됨
AnswerDate 처리일시 date - 판매자문의 답변처리 시간
- YYYY-MM-DD hh:mm:ss+09:00 형식으로 조회됨
GoodsNo 마스터상품번호 string 2.0 상품 경우 ESM 마스터번호 조회됨
SiteGoodsNo Site 상품번호 string Site 상품번호 조회됨
PayNo 장바구니번호 string 대표 장바구니번호 조회됨
OrderNo 주문번호 string - 대표 주문번호 조회됨
- 데이터 없을 경우, 옥션 "0" / G마켓 "-"로 내려감
orderType 주문종류 string 참고용 데이터로, 아래 텍스트로 내려감
일반주문,물류주문,상품문의는 null
SellStatus 판매진행상태 string 참고용 데이터(현재 옥션만 지원)
접수 시점 해당 주문의 최종 주문상태
예) 교환물품도착, 반품보류 등
Title 제목 string 문의 제목
Details 내용 string 문의 내용
옥션은 채팅형으로 판매자가 답변하기 이전 문의를 묶어서 채팅순으로 조회됨
판매자가 답변 후 재문의한 경우 "[처리완료내역][문의번호:최신문의번호]History내용" 으로 기존 문의한 내용이 내려감(판매자 답변 내용은 내려가지 않으므로 문의번호로 조회 필요)
미처리된 내용은 [미처리][문의번호:]로 내려감
InquirerName 문의자명 string 문의자 이름
InquirerPhone 문의자연락처 string 문의자 전화번호
branchId 지점코드 string 당배관 판매자위함(추후 제공)

 JSON_Success

{
  "qnaType": 0,
  "reAsking": true,
  "inquirerName": "string",
  "inquirerPhone": "string",
  "branchId": "string",
  "messageNo": "string",
  "sellerId": "string",
  "goodsNo": "string",
  "siteGoodsNo": "string",
  "orderNo": "string",
  "orderType": "string",
  "sellStatus": "string",
  "payNo": "string",
  "informStatus": "string",
  "receiveDate": "2019-04-15T07:55:06+09:00",
  "answerDate": "2019-04-15T07:55:06+09:00",
  "contractType": "string",
  "title": "string",
  "details": "string",
  "token": "string"
}

JSON_Fail

{
  "resultCode": 0,
  "message": "string"
}

Sample Code_Success

지마켓
[
 {
  "qnaType":3,
  "reAsking":false,
  "inquirerName":"고객명",
  "inquirerPhone":"010-1234-5678",
  "branchId":null,
  "messageNo":"375419346",
  "sellerId":"sellerid_test",
  "goodsNo":"1149444776",
  "siteGoodsNo":"1527058123",
  "orderNo":"2949069764",
  "orderType":"일반주문",
  "sellStatus":"-",
  "payNo":"4456043527",
  "informStatus":"처리완료",
  "receiveDate":"2019-04-15T04:05:00+09:00",
  "answerDate":"0001-01-01T00:00:00+09:00",
  "contractType":"상품",
  "title":"가장 최근 도정한 쌀로 배송 부탁드립니다",
  "details":"가장 최근 도정한 쌀로 배송 부탁드립니다",
  "token":"!CB+jUisBwjBTI1i3FNGgn5QHqBuWT0T+j4xvGEAEnap/xSdrxDUnpMNIQYoKctP3tAj0KJ0amY97Hfrpqbuy8A=="
 }
]

옥션
[
 {
  "qnaType":1,
  "reAsking":true,
  "inquirerName":"고객명",
  "inquirerPhone":"010-1234-5678",
  "branchId":null,
  "messageNo":"215952467",
  "sellerId":"sellerid_test",
  "goodsNo":"2300050758",
  "siteGoodsNo":"B642025679",
  "orderNo":"0",
  "orderType":"",
  "sellStatus":"-",
  "payNo":"-",
  "informStatus":"미처리",
  "receiveDate":"2019-04-01T01:29:00+09:00",
  "answerDate":"2019-04-01T08:45:00+09:00",
  "contractType":"교환",
   "title":"안녕하세요",
  "details":"[처리완료내역][문의번호: 215952273]안녕하세요\n 교환가능할지 문의드립니다 \n[미처리][문의번호: 215952467]언제 답변받을 수 있나요?",
  "token":"!aTZ74zqPIImaqRkDvn8JUz/r173SHmXAoljxKI9kP9MvNXaKZ9gzCguvpDI36TlFzSju8JetoYyz3sMH95IRSg=="
 }
]

Sample Code_Fail

{
    "resultCode": 1000,
    "message": "7일 기간이상 조회 요청이 불가능합니다."
}

 

Error Code

결과코드 메시지 원인
1000 조회된 기간에 조회 대상이 없습니다 기간 내 문의건이 없을 경우
1000 7일 기간이상 조회 요청이 불가능합니다. 조회기간 날짜가 7일을 초과할 경우

 

'CS API' 카테고리의 다른 글

판매자문의 답변 API  (0) 2022.11.03
긴급알리미 조회 API  (0) 2022.11.03
긴급알리미 답변 API  (0) 2022.11.03
ESM 공지사항 조회 API  (0) 2022.09.30